gnunet-svn
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[GNUnet-SVN] r30724 - gnunet/src/mesh


From: gnunet
Subject: [GNUnet-SVN] r30724 - gnunet/src/mesh
Date: Fri, 15 Nov 2013 14:16:40 +0100

Author: bartpolot
Date: 2013-11-15 14:16:40 +0100 (Fri, 15 Nov 2013)
New Revision: 30724

Modified:
   gnunet/src/mesh/gnunet-service-mesh_tunnel.c
Log:
- fix NACK handling (related to cov 10832)


Modified: gnunet/src/mesh/gnunet-service-mesh_tunnel.c
===================================================================
--- gnunet/src/mesh/gnunet-service-mesh_tunnel.c        2013-11-15 13:12:52 UTC 
(rev 30723)
+++ gnunet/src/mesh/gnunet-service-mesh_tunnel.c        2013-11-15 13:16:40 UTC 
(rev 30724)
@@ -973,10 +973,10 @@
 
 
 /**
- * Handle channel NACK.
+ * Handle channel NACK: check correctness and call channel handler for NACKs.
  *
- * @param t Tunnel on which the data came.
- * @param msg Data message.
+ * @param t Tunnel on which the NACK came.
+ * @param msg NACK message.
  */
 static void
 handle_ch_nack (struct MeshTunnel3 *t,
@@ -995,7 +995,7 @@
 
   /* Check channel */
   ch = GMT_get_channel (t, ntohl (msg->chid));
-  if (NULL != ch && ! GMT_is_loopback (t))
+  if (NULL == ch)
   {
     GNUNET_STATISTICS_update (stats, "# channel NACK on unknown channel",
                               1, GNUNET_NO);




reply via email to

[Prev in Thread] Current Thread [Next in Thread]